Frequently Asked Questions About What Your Pet’S Sleeping Position Means
what does it mean when my dog sleeps in a ball?
When your dog curls into a tight ball, it often signifies a need for security and warmth. This position protects vital organs and helps conserve body heat, suggesting they feel safe enough to relax but are still instinctively guarding themselves. It can also indicate cooler environmental temperatures.
how do cats sleep on their back and what does it mean?
A cat sleeping on its back with belly exposed is a strong indicator of trust and comfort. This vulnerable position reveals their most sensitive area, suggesting they feel completely secure in their surroundings and with those nearby. It’s a sign of ultimate relaxation and contentment.
why does my dog sleep sprawled out?
Sprawled-out sleeping positions in dogs, often with legs splayed in various directions, typically mean they are feeling very relaxed and uninhibited. This posture allows for maximum heat dissipation, indicating they are comfortable with the ambient temperature and confident in their safety.
which sleeping positions mean my cat is stressed?
Cats exhibiting tense, upright sleeping positions, or those who remain alert with ears swiveling, may be experiencing stress. If a cat sleeps in a crouched, ready-to-pounce posture or frequently wakes, it suggests an underlying anxiety or a perceived lack of safety in their environment.
can you tell if a dog is dreaming by its sleeping position?
While not solely determined by position, rapid eye movement (REM) sleep, often accompanied by twitching paws or muffled barks, suggests dreaming. A dog in a relaxed, somewhat contorted position during REM sleep might be more likely to exhibit these dream behaviors, indicating active cognitive processing.

Understanding what your pet’s sleeping position means can offer profound insights, but sometimes common patterns can be misinterpreted. Age and breed are critical variables. For instance, a senior dog may adopt a curled position for thermoregulation, a behavior that might be mistaken for anxiety in a younger animal. Similarly, brachycephalic breeds, like Pugs, often sleep in a splayed position to facilitate respiration, a necessity not indicative of discomfort.

Q: My pet is sleeping in unusual locations. What does this mean?
A: A pet seeking novel sleeping spots might be attempting to regulate their body temperature or avoid environmental stressors. For example, a dog might seek cooler tile floors during warmer periods. However, a consistent pattern of hiding or sleeping in confined spaces could signal anxiety or pain.
